description | Provided are systems and methods related to calibration courses and calibration targets, which can be configured for calibrating sensors used in vehicles, such as vehicles that include autonomous or semi-autonomous vehicle systems, or other mobile robots. As an example, a system can include a drivable path comprising a plurality of turns, a plurality of calibration targets proximate to the drivable path, and a plurality of obstacles in the drivable path. The plurality of calibration targets are positioned so as to be detectable by at least one sensor of a vehicle as the vehicle traverses the drivable path, and at least one particular obstacle of the plurality of obstacles changes an angle of the at least one sensor relative to at least one calibration target as the vehicle traverses the drivable path. |
